Poor Fellow
Originally released in 1974. Poor Fellow is a drama film. directed by Reza Safai.
Starring Nematollah Aghasi, Haleh Nazari, and Hosein Gil
Synopsis
"Nemat" is a simple shepherd who marries a girl named "Satare". Setare is the target of a smuggler named "Jasem". Nemat gets into a fight with him over Setare and ends up in prison with Jasem's shoes. In Nemat's absence, Setare, out of fear of Jasem, goes to the desert with "Tuba" (Nemat's sister who was raped by Jasem). When Nemat returns, when Jasem spreads rumors against Setare, Touba, who hates Jasem deeply, kills him in a fight and goes to prison herself. Nemat and Setare also start a simple life.
